SonicWall NSv SERIES VIRTUAL FIREWALL
NSv Series virtual firewall offers all the security advantages of a physical firewall with the operational and economic benefits of virtualization, including system scalability, agility, speed of provisioning, simple management.
NSv shields all components of private/public cloud environments from resource misuse, cross-virtual-machine and side-channel attacks and common exploits and threats.
Features
- Next-gen firewall with automated real-time breach detection and prevention capabilities
- Patent-pending Real-Time Deep Memory Inspection (RTDMI) technology
- Patented Reassembly-Free Deep Packet Inspection (RFDPI) technology
- Complete end-to-end visibility and streamlined management with Unified Policy
- Application intelligence and control
- Segmentation security and security zoning
- Supports ESXi, Hyper-V, KVM, Nutanix and AWS, Azure public cloud

- API
- Yes
- What users can and can't do using the API
- There is a fully restful API available for the SonicWall NSv. It allows comands to be sent to configure the appliance (all web UI configuration is support in API). The API also allows for information to be retrieved from the appliance - such as status of a policy, if a rule has been consumed, event details etc.

- Users can be authenticed via LDAP, RADIUS, TACACS+ and local user database. Third party MFA solutions are optionally supported.
- Access restrictions in management interfaces and support channels
- The management infercae can be restricted by only giving access to specified acccounts of your choosing. Further more access can be limited by public IP to your chosen address. For access to support channels this would be acheieved via mysonicwall.com. An account is needed in order to register the device. Mysonicwall.com requires a username and password as well as optional MFA.
